Hi1. I'm a PC repair guy who has a customer who is having problems with PCA 8.0. I've checked out the Win98SE and it seems to be in good shape - no hideous problems I can find and MSWord seems to run fine. This PC is networked to a server running NT 4.0 . I have no experience with Peachtree and can use any help I can get from you folks.
PCA generates an error message when she tries to print sales invoices - the invoice prints but PCA crashes. The error message is "MSGSRV32 caused a general protection fault in module kernel32.dll at 0187:bff719f5". This happens about 75% of the time. She is trying to print to a Panasonic KX-P2130 printer (pretty old printer) that handles her multicopy forms. I can print to the same printer from Windows Printer Test Page and from Word with no problem.
This error also occurs on another PC on her network when trying to do the same thing.
Other error messages show up as well.
"Peachw caused an exception 10H in module PCHLIB32.dll at 0187:1900e546"
Only on other PC:
The following error occured when trying to print checks - after the first one printed correctly.
"PeachW caused an invalid page fault in module MSVBVM60.dll at 0187:66069362"
I don't recall what caused this one-
"Peachw caused exception 10H in module Peachw.exe at 0187:04212e2b".
My gut feeling is that:
1) she should get a newer printer with uptodate drivers (she has the latest ones that Panasonic offers (for Win95!).
2) She should uninstall then reinstall PCA 8.0 and any patches that are available.
